## Victoria Ruffo’s Support for Eugenio Derbez

Victoria Ruffo has publicly defended Eugenio Derbez following the backlash he received over his reaction to the sudden passing of Gabriela Michel, Aislinn Derbez’s mother. The actress’s statements have sparked a conversation about grief and the expectations surrounding public figures during moments of personal loss.

### A Shared Experience of Grief

In a recent press conference, Ruffo expressed her condolences and solidarity with Aislinn, sharing her personal experiences of losing her own mother. “I have not spoken to her, but, through the cameras, I sent her a message of solidarity,” Ruffo stated. Her heartfelt words aimed to provide comfort to Aislinn during this difficult time.

Ruffo emphasized the profound difficulties of losing a mother: “I hope she finds resignation soon, because losing a mother is very difficult.”

### Family Dynamics Amid Grief

When questioned about her son, José Eduardo Derbez’s connection with Aislinn, Ruffo confirmed their communication. Discussing the grieving process, she noted, “That depends on each person… how you react and how you move forward.” This perspective opens the discussion on how grief varies dramatically from person to person, especially in the context of public figures.

### Criticism of Eugenio Derbez

The conversation quickly shifted to the criticism directed at Eugenio Derbez. Critics accused him of being insensitive after he appeared smiling at the International Emmy Awards shortly after the announcement of Gabriela Michel’s death. Many found his public demeanor inappropriate given the circumstances.

Ruffo addressed these accusations with conviction: “The mother’s death caught everyone off guard, right? It wasn’t expected, and she was very young.” Her words highlight the unexpected nature of death and the varying responses that can occur as a result.

### Personal Reflections on Loss

Ruffo also shared her own ongoing struggle with loss, recounting her mother’s passing: “Well, I still haven’t gotten over it. Every day I remember my mom.” This sentiment resonates widely, capturing the complexities of grief that do not simply disappear after a period of mourning.

### Aislinn’s Request for Privacy

In the wake of her mother’s passing, Aislinn Derbez also spoke out, asking for respect as she navigates her grief. Through her social media, she shared, “At this moment I need to live my grief in peace, in the company of my family.” Her request underlines the importance of privacy during such personal struggles.
